Transaction 306934e04f61ce8c867fac1134a04574c7ad9bd8852a574975b3249c8d6056d1
1 Input
1 Output
-
306934e04f61ce8c867fac1134a04574c7ad9bd8852a574975b3249c8d6056d1:0
- value
- 18846842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7119deff35be44e6ac809a59b8ec6a11c06d45f4 OP_EQUAL
- address
- 3C13GmttG5Zqmztp5tX2U9TeGJzEodKKq6